Very nice! Looks great. Welcome to the forum. Do you have the xm server already installed with the antenna? If you do you have to get the number/letters combo from station 1 or 0 and create an account on the xm/sirious site, pick a plan, put in your info and that number off the radio or paper that came with it, send the signal the radio wait a bit 15-20 minutes and enjoy commercial free radio.would get clear bra installed if you're looking to do something like that.

window tint, shift knob, de-badge the trunk because it's so cluttered with all that chrome badging, rally armor mud flaps, rims. Those things shouldn't void any warranty. That's all I cant think of at the moment.

I also installed the factory trunk sub which is plug and play and very easy install and fits nicely in the side of the trunk and has pretty good sound. I did that when i installed my xm receiver/antenna. Also did the under the dash aka footwell illumination lights under the dash when i did the xm and sub, again those are plug and play as well if you get the subie ones. But if you did these yourself and you run into an issue down the road they would probably give you hard time about warranting it. I installed them myself, I'm fully capable of doing it, the dealer charges too much to do when I can do it and know it's done right and I am happy with it.

I remember when I bought my car, I was fully against any mods because I didn't want to void my warranty after a year I got over that feeling and went stage 2 over the summer FOL!

EDIT: I don't know how you feel about the chrome/silver fender badges but you can plasidip them or I bought the new badges from the 2013 tangerine special edition and replaced them. They are just stuck on with 3m tape.
